Solid wood offers strength, durability, and beauty that cannot be achieved from manufactured wood such as MDF or particle board. Additionally, different species of wood have different aesthetic and structural properties. Hardwoods such as oak , cherry, and walnut are much denser and often have unique natural coloring that can change and become more beautiful as the wood ages. Softwoods such as pine and spruce are much more affordable and have a wider range of achievable coloring through stains and paints. In general, hardwoods are more costly than softwoods but add the benefit of natural patinas and a greater durability than softwood species.
